Cod sursa(job #1854737)

Utilizator amaliarebAmalia Rebegea amaliareb Data 23 ianuarie 2017 10:47:43
Problema Factorial Scor 5
Compilator cpp Status done
Runda Arhiva de probleme Marime 0.39 kb
#include <iostream>
#include <fstream>

using namespace std;
ifstream f("fact.in");
ofstream g("fact.out");
long long p,n,i,pas,L=32,r;

int nr5(int n)
{
    int nr;
    while(n)
    {
        nr=n/5;
        n/=5;
    }
    return nr;
}

int main()
{
    f>>p;
    pas=1<<L;
    r=0;
    while(pas)
    {
        if(nr5(r+pas)<p) r+=pas;
        pas/=2;
    }
    g<<r+1<<'\n';
    return 0;
}